On July 18, 2012, Old South Church’s own Dr. Dan Oates was interviewed on the Callie Crossley Radio Show to talk about Independence at Home (IAH). Congressman Ed Markey, co-author of the IAH legislation, was also interviewed.
Old South Church member Paula Hammond was featured as one of 12 Bostonians Changing the World in the Boston Globe on June 15, 2012. Paula is a professor in chemical engineering at the Massachusetts Insititue of Technology.
